Landmark Court Ruling Upholds Right to Healthy Environment
April 18, 2024
April 18, 2024
NEW YORK, April 18 [Category: International] -- Human Rights Watch issued the following news:
Last month, the Inter-American Court of Human Rights found the Peruvian government responsible for violating the right to a healthy environment, among other rights, of residents of La Oroya, a town exposed to toxic pollution from a mine and smelter complex, the first ruling of its kind before the Court.
